icon

Registration open for AY 2026!

Register Now

Database Management System (DBMS): Definition, Types, Examples & Why It Matters Today

A Database Management System (DBMS) is software that stores, organizes, and manages data efficiently. It helps users access, update, and secure information in databases. This guide explains DBMS concepts, different types like relational and NoSQL databases, popular examples, and its importance in modern applications, businesses, websites, and data-driven technologies today.
authorImageShivam Singh20 May, 2026
Database Management System

Introduction to Database Management System (DBMS)

Data are out there on your phone and in your apps; and even for that food delivery you just ordered. But how does all that data get stored, retrieved, and organized in the most efficient way? The answer to that is a database management system (DBMS). Call it the invisible engine that drives the applications and systems we depend on every other day. 

This blog will serve as a guide on what is a database management system, its operation, and the various kinds of systems that are being utilized today. Whether one is a student just starting their techno-foray or a working professional trying to shine up on some basics, this is the guide to go to.

What is a Database Management System (DBMS)?

Database Management Systems (DBMS) are programs for easily storing, managing, retrieving, and manipulating data. It’s essentially an advanced filing cabinet for digital data.

Instead of creating a host of different places for the storage of data, the DBMS is a central location under which all data can be safely managed, organized, and accessed whenever needed. 

TaAn ke, for example, when you search for a song using a music app: the database management system provides it almost instantly. This is how quick and efficient a DBMS is.

Why Use a Database Management System (DBMS)?

This is why DBMSs are very much essential:

  • It cuts down redundancy by having a centralized organization of data.

  • Data security: Access is provided only to authorized personnel.

  • Backup and recovery are built-in.

  • Multi-user access is facilitated.

  • Simple to query: The required info is fetched in a jiffy.

Basically, a database management system (DBMS) makes the computer world smart, safe, and fast.

Types of Database Management Systems (DBMS)

Let’s systematically address the major types of database management systems (DBMS), based on their data structure and necessities:

1. Relational Database Management System

A relational database management system stores data in tables (rows and columns). Each row is a record and each column is an attribute of data. These tables are related to each other by means of keys.

Examples: MySQL, PostgreSQL, Oracle.

Their applications include banking, e-commerce, HR systems, and every other domain that requires structured data.

2. NoSQL Database Management System

The NoSQL DBMS is used to store unstructured or semi-structured data. It does not abide by the traditional table-based model.

Example: MongoDB, Cassandra, Redis.

Some instances of a NoSQL database management system (DBMS) would be, social media interaction data or IoT data fetching in real-time and on a huge scale.

3. Hierarchical Database Management System

A hierarchical DBMS tends to store data in a tree-like system with records having parent-child relationships. 

Example: IBM’s IMS.

Although older, this type of DBMS is still operational in certain legacy systems such as airline reservations and telecommunications.

4. Network Database Management System

The network DBMS is much like a hierarchical model except for the fact that it includes multiple parent-child links thereby creating more complex relationships.

Example: Integrated Data Store (IDS).

This kind of DBMS was more flexible than the hierarchical one.

Real-Life Database Management System Examples

To make it feel less alien, here are some examples of real-world database management systems: 

  • DBMS is used by Amazon for managing inventory and user data.

  • DBMS accounts for storing user profiles, posts, and interactions by Facebook.

  • Banks use relational DBMS for storing accounts, transactions, and clients.

  • Hospitals use DBMS for secure management of patient records. 

Such examples already demonstrate how essential the database management system (DBMS) is in a variety of fields.

Core Components of a Database Management System (DBMS)

Making our way through some of the internal cogs of a database management system (DBMS):

  • Database engine - Retrieves and processes data requests.

  • Data definition language (DDL) - Helps in database design.

  • Data manipulation language (DML) - An interface for inserting, deleting, and updating data.

  • Query processor - Converts user queries into machine-understandable instructions.

These components engage to keep your DBMS operating like a well-oiled machine.

Security in Database Management System (DBMS)

A database management system (DBMS) has security layers built within it, such as:

  • Authentication: The system shall only accept verified users.

  • Authorization: Properly assigned roles and permissions for the users.

  • Encryption: Sensitive data are encrypted to render the information useless should hackers obtain it.

Such layers are exceptionally paramount in sectors such as healthcare, banking, and the government, where data privacy is a top priority. 

Future of Database Management System (DBMS)

The future of database management system (DBMS) would tilt towards-

  • Cloud-based DBMS for worldwide access and scalability.

  • AI-based DBMS for trend analysis and task automation.

  • Blockchain-integrated DBMS for making sure the records are tamper-proof.

So if you're considering either beginning your career or sharpening your skills, it's a cool thing to learn about database management systems (DBMS). 

Build Your Future with PW IOI School of Technology's B.Tech in Computer Science

Want to be a master of data and tech? Aiming at the next-gen innovators, the PW IOI School of Technology offers a B.Tech in Computer Science. Teaching programming, cloud, and of course database management systems (DBMS) by experts delivering industry-relevant project work. Begin your journey to becoming a tech leader today.

 

Database Management System FAQ

Is an Excel spreadsheet actually a database management system (DBMS)?

An Excel sheet is simply a spreadsheet tool and is incapable of functioning even close to a bona fide DBMS. There is no provision for data integrity or for advanced security features.

Which type of database management system (DBMS) should I learn first?

A person should begin his learning adventure with an RDBMS such as MySQL or PostgreSQL because they are not only easy to learn but also common.

Is coding required to use a database management system (DBMS)?

Yes, there are many database management systems with GUI tools like phpMyAdmin. But knowing SQL will definitely help.

How is NoSQL different from an RDBMS?

An RDBMS system stores data in a tabular form, while a NoSQL system stores data in formats such as documents, graphs, or key-values, allowing a little more freedom in that area.
avatar

Get Free Counselling Today

and Clear up all your Doubts

Talk to Our Counsellor just by filling out the form.
Student Name
Phone Number
IN
+91
OTP